Confident Body, Confident Child
A Positive, Evidence-Based Approach to Raising Body-Confident Kids
Confident Body Confident Child (CBCC) is an internationally recognized, evidence-based prevention program designed to help parents, caregivers, and educators nurture healthy body image, positive eating behaviors, and strong self-worth in children ages 2–12. Why Early Prevention Matters
Children begin absorbing cultural messages about appearance and weight shockingly early. These messages—whether online, in peer groups, or even within their own households—can shape how a child feels about their body and their worth.
Confident Body Confident Child intervenes long before those beliefs solidify, helping adults create environments where:
All bodies are respected
Food is approached without shame or fear
Children learn to trust and care for their own bodies
Confidence is built on character, abilities, and values– not appearance
By strengthening a child’s emotional foundation, we support lifelong resilience, self-compassion, and a healthier relationship with food and body image.
What the Program Covers
CBCC provides adults with practical, research-driven strategies, including:
How to talk about bodies in positive, inclusive, and nonjudgmental ways
How to respond when a child expresses body dissatisfaction
Tools to reduce harmful weight-focused talk at home and in classrooms
Approaches to mealtimes that support attuned, responsive eating
Ways to counteract unrealistic beauty ideals and media pressures
How to model self-acceptance and confidence for young children
Participants receive guidance, scripts, activities, and take-home resources that make these strategies easy to implement in everyday life.
